You could go to Lamont today. You know, reading period next week, sophomore essay. You could. But there'll be children's games, costumes, booths from 25 countries, and a parade at the ISA Fun Fair from noon to midnight today. Also, small Oriental steaks, grape leaves, apple strudle, and an international gift shop. But you could go to Lamont.
